SPRINGFIELD, Mo. – Evangel Baseball returns home on Tuesday (Mar. 17) afternoon to host the Avila Eagles for a single nine-inning matchup at University Field.
First pitch for the matchup is set for 2:00 p.m. tomorrow, as EU looks to take the series with a win.
SERIES HISTORY
Evangel is 20-43 all-time against Avila, but took the win on the road earlier this season, 6-5.
OPENING STORYLINES
-
Evangel is currently 13-15 this season, as the Valor are coming off a road series win over the York Panthers.
-
Justus Cherrico leads Evangel in batting average (.400), with Quentin Edwards leading the team in home runs (5). Evan Jno-Baptiste leads EU in runs (27) and RBIs (29).
-
Heath Perry has drawn a team high 21 walks so far this season.
-
Riley Fuller leads EU in innings pitched (34.0), while Mason Reilly leads the Valor in ERA (3.27).
-
In their last matchup with the Eagles, Baptiste led EU at the plate, going 4-5 with three runs scored and three RBIs, as Brayden Epperhart earned the win.
